Fall Tree Care: Pruning for Health and Safety
As the leaves begin to turn vibrant hues of orange and red, it's a timely reminder that fall is the ideal season for tree care. Pruning your trees after the winter months can significantly enhance their health and minimize potential hazards come spring. By removing dead, diseased, or weak branches, you're creating a more resilient and healthy canopy.
- Pruning also helps to promote air circulation, which can reduce the risk of fungal diseases.
- Furthermore, proper pruning can help to form your trees and keep them manageable
Remember, always use sharp and clean tools for pruning and follow safe practices to minimize any potential injuries.
